import time
import sys
import signal
import socket
from typing import Callable
from spinnman.connections.udp_packet_connections import IPAddressesConnection


[docs] def locate_connected_machine(handler: Callable[[str, float], None]): """ Locates any SpiNNaker machines IP addresses from the auto-transmitted packets from non-booted SpiNNaker machines. :param ~collections.abc.Callable handler: A callback that decides whether to stop searching. The callback is given two arguments: the IP address found and the current time. It should return True if the search should cease. """ connection = IPAddressesConnection() seen_boards = set() while True: ip_address = connection.receive_ip_address() now = time.time() if ip_address is not None and ip_address not in seen_boards: seen_boards.add(ip_address) if handler(ip_address, now): break
if __name__ == "__main__": def _ctrlc_handler(sig, frame): """ :return: Never returns as it causes a sys.exit() """ # pylint: disable=unused-argument print("Exiting") sys.exit() def _print_connected(ip_address: str, timestamp: float): try: hostname = f" ({socket.gethostbyaddr(ip_address)[0]})" except Exception: # pylint: disable=broad-except hostname = "" print(f"{ip_address}{hostname} at {timestamp}") return False print("The following addresses might be SpiNNaker boards " "(press Ctrl-C to quit):") signal.signal(signal.SIGINT, _ctrlc_handler) locate_connected_machine(handler=_print_connected)
